Backend Engineer

IT Jobs: Backend Engineer

Application ends:


BandLab is seeking to hire a Backend Engineer in Singapore or remote who will be focusing on BandLab social features such as Feed, Notifications, Chat, Sharing, Live streaming, and Comments. . This is a remote position. If you’re considering this role as a remote opportunity outside of Singapore, please note that we operate within the GMT+2 to GMT+9 time zones. If you’re based outside of this range, you’ll need to adjust your schedule to align with the team’s working hours.

Responsibilities

  • End-to-end ownership of systems you build: estimating, designing, developing, code review, documentation, testing, deploying, monitoring, and performance optimization
  • Collaborate with team members on design and implementation
  • Communicate with other teams during the analysis and development phase
  • Design and build APIs
  • Write unit, functional, and end-to-end tests
  • Develop new and maintain the existing features
  • Maintain the infrastructure of high-load Social services (Feed, Chat, etc.) that serves millions of users
  • Work with a large codebase written in .NET C#
  • Improve scalability and performance of the existing services
  • Optimize the costs of the existing cloud infrastructure (Azure and AWS)

Qualifications

  • Previous experience with building social networks and/or SaaS
  • Proficiency in at least one of .NET (C#/F#), Java, Node.js, Go
  • Hands-on experience building highly scalable distributed systems with microservice architecture
  • Working experience with SQL and NoSQL databases
  • Experience working with cloud services (AWS/Azure) and cloud-native applications
  • Understanding of software engineering best practices including unit testing, continuous integration, continuous deployment, and source control
  • Commitment to high-quality and maintainable software
  • Hands-on experience with serverless technologies and techniques
  • Practical experience with IaC (e.g. Azure ARM, AWS CloudFormation, Pulumi)
  • Understanding of CQRS and Event Sourcing

Singapore HQ benefits:

  • Healthcare, dental insurance
  • Quarterly bonus
  • Paid annual leave, sick leave, childcare leave, volunteer leave and maternity leave
  • BandLab Technologies staff discount

Remote work benefits:

  • Paid annual leave
Share
Facebook
Twitter
LinkedIn
WhatsApp
Telegram